患有心力衰竭的患者的口渴症状:综合性审查

概括
本综述确定了心力衰竭 (HF) 患者口渴的风险和保护因素. 它还强调了各种干预措施,强调了个性化护理和需要更多的研究来改善症状管理.
科学领域:
- 心脏病学 心脏病学
- 护理科学 护理科学
- 症状管理 症状管理
背景情况:
- 饥渴是心力衰竭 (HF) 患者的常见和令人痛苦的症状.
- 了解影响口渴的因素和有效的干预措施对于改善患者福祉和疾病管理至关重要.
研究的目的:
- 确定与心力衰竭患者口渴症状相关的风险和保护因素.
- 探索干预策略,以缓解这一群体的口渴.
主要方法:
- 对21篇文章进行了综合性审查.
- 在十个电子数据库 (如PubMed,Embase) 和灰色文献中进行文献搜索.
- 使用混合方法评估工具进行质量评估.
主要成果:
- 确定了六个风险因素主题:人口统计,疾病严重程度,心理环境,药物,液体限制和平衡.
- 保护因素包括增加液体摄入量,积极的限制态度和ARB使用.
- 确定了五种干预策略:传统中医,薄荷,酸味,改善水限制和集群护理.
结论:
- 医疗保健专业人员应专注于减轻HF患者口渴的已确定的风险因素.
- 干预选择必须考虑患者的偏好和文化背景,以便更好地遵守.
- 需要进一步的多中心大样本研究来验证干预的有效性.

Regulation of Water Intake
499
Osmolality refers to the number of solute particles per kilogram of solvent in a solution. Plasma osmolality specifically indicates the total number of solute particles per kilogram of water in blood plasma. This value reflects the body's hydration status and is tightly regulated through mechanisms controlling water intake and output. Pathophysiology of Heart Failure
1.6K
Heart failure (HF) is a progressive syndrome involving ventricles that leads to inadequate cardiac output. It can be classified based on location and output or ejection fraction. Ejection fraction (EF) is an essential measurement in the diagnosis and surveillance of HF. Reduced EF corresponds to systolic heart failure (HFrEF). Heart Failure Drugs: Inhibitors of Renin-Angiotensin System
421
The activation of the sympathetic nervous system and the renin-angiotensin-aldosterone system (RAAS) contributes to cardiac remodeling, and inhibiting the RAAS is a pharmacological target in heart failure management. As a result, neurohumoral modulation is a crucial treatment principle for managing heart failure.
